Beer Review: Yuengling Black & Tan


Crisper than some B & T's that I have had -- due to an emphasis on the 'T' perhaps? -- this was not very smooth. No coffee or chocolate notes were present, although the overall taste was a good one. This brew had a little 'roundness' to it. Not the best B & T I've ever had, but an okay brew. It worked well washing down my excellent lasagna, so what more could I ask? -- Brewmeister G

The Brewer? Yuengling Brewery - - - - - - - When tasted? 05 March 2002
Place of Origin? Pottsville, Pennsylvania - - - - - - - How tasted? 8 oz draft
Style of Beer? Black & Tan - - - - - - - Where tasted? At the Gingerbread Man restaurant, Gettysburg, PA
